About LDA Design
At LDA Design, we make great places and shape the world around us for the better. We do this by connecting people and place through landscape. The origin of the word landscape is to create a place where people belong. We follow the principles of ‘first life, then spaces, then buildings’. Whether we are designing a new district, restoring a park or regenerating an estate, we start with what people want and need. LDA Design led the final landscape masterplan and detailed design for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park, one of Europe’s most successful new parklands. We have designed and delivered some of the UK’s most challenging city centre public realm projects, including London’s Battersea Power Station, Stratford Waterfront and Strand Aldwych. This work includes George Street in Edinburgh and the transformation of public realm in Newcastle City Centre. We have developed a public realm strategy for Liverpool that will shape the centre for the next 25 years. Our award-winning partnership with Camden has transformed West End streets, carving out new green space and creating a healthier, safer, and more pleasant experience for pedestrians and cyclists. The climate crisis is the biggest challenge of our generation. As the UK weans itself off fossil fuels, a substantially increased demand for a reliable and secure mix of low-carbon energy lies ahead. Our long-standing commitment to renewable energy, since its infancy, places us at the forefront to help clients respond to this global challenge. Our experience, together with our creativity and practical appreciation of issues, allow us to provide robust advice and leadership that reflects an understanding of commerciality, risk and opportunity. We helped secure consent for Hornsea Three, which will be the UK’s largest offshore windfarm. LDA Design is proud to be 100% employee owned. We are landscape architects, urban designers, planners, environmental planners and EIA coordinators.
